✦ Synopsis


A scintillant monomer, 2,5-diphenyl-4-vinyloxazole, has been synthesised and co-polymerised with 4ethylstyrene, divinylbenzene and 4-vinylbenzyl chloride in the presence of a toluene porogen, to form a scintillant-containing macroporous resin. Despite prolonged exposure to organic solvent, this resin retains the ability to scintillate efficiently in the presence of ionising radiation.
